How does Copilot compare to Cursor for security?

Both Copilot and Cursor generate code with similar security characteristics since they use comparable AI models. Copilot integrates directly into VS Code and JetBrains IDEs as an autocomplete tool, while Cursor is a standalone AI-first editor with chat-based code generation. Neither tool validates the security of its suggestions. Cursor gives you more control over prompts and context, which can help you request security-conscious code, while Copilot rapid-fire suggestions may lead to accepting vulnerable code faster.
